Cantillon Monk's Café Cuvée Kriek is a | Cantillon Monk's Café Cuvée Kriek is a kriek blend made specifically for [http://www.monkscafe.com Monk's Café] in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ania. The fruit was a Morello (variety: Kelleris) sour cherry sourced in Belgium. The cask was hand selected by Tom Peters of [http://www.monkscafe.com Monk's Café] and Jean Van Roy. | ||

This beer was only available on draft during special events at | This beer was only available on draft during special events at Monk's Café. A few bottles were briefly observed at Cantillon in 2011 but were never publicly available. | ||
